Traction Control System Issues in the 2015 CHEVROLET COLORADO

2 traction control system complaints have been filed with NHTSA for the 2015 CHEVROLET COLORADO. Of these, 0 involved a crash, 0 involved a fire, and 0 resulted in injury.

The contact owns a 2015 Chevrolet Colorado. The contact stated while driving 35 MPH, the vehicle lost power steering functionality. The contact lost control of the vehicle, with the traction control warning light illuminated. The contact restarted the vehicle, but the failure persisted. The dealer was not notified of the failure. The vehicle was not repaired. The manufacturer was notified of the failure. The failure mileage was approximately 102,000.

TL* THE CONTACT OWNS A 2015 CHEVROLET COLORADO. THE CONTACT STATED THAT THE POWER STEERING LOOSES POWER WHILE DRIVING. THE POWER STEERING, TRACTION CONTROL WARNING LIGHT ILLUMINATED. IN ADDITION, POWER STEERING INACTIVE DRIVE WITH CAUTION, AND A SHAM NOISE ACCORDED MESSAGES DISPLAYED. THE CONTACT WAS ABLE TO COASTED TO THE SIDE OF THE ROAD AND POWERED OFF THE ENGINE. THE VEHICLE WAS RESTARTED AND WAS ABLE TO DRIVE AS NORMAL. THE CONTACT STATED THE FAILURE RECURRED INTERMITTENTLY. THE VEHICLE WAS TAKEN TO AUTONATION CHEVROLET AUSTIN DEALER (11400 RESEARCH BLVD, AUSTIN, TX 78759, (512) 592-3197) AND WAS DIAGNOSED THAT THE CO545 CODE VERIFIED TOUCH SENSOR FAULT FAILED INTERNALLY IN THE STEERING GEAR NEEDED TO BE REPLACED. THE VEHICLE WAS NOT REPAIRED. THE MANUFACTURER WAS MADE AWARE OF THE FAILURE AND PROVIDED A CASE NUMBER: THE FAILURE MILEAGE WAS APPROXIMATELY 95,000.
